Chinese immigrants began arriving in Nevada after 1849 primarily due to the California Gold Rush, which spurred a massive influx of people seeking fortune and opportunity in the American West. Many Chinese immigrants sought work in mining and other industries, as well as in support services for the burgeoning settler population. The promise of economic opportunity and the demand for labor in mining towns attracted them to Nevada, where they contributed significantly to the region's development.

What jobs did Asian immigrants have in the late 1800 and early 1900?

Asian immigrants in the late 1800s and early 1900s often worked in labor-intensive industries such as mining, railroad construction, agriculture, and domestic service. Many Chinese immigrants, for example, were employed as laborers on the Transcontinental Railroad in the United States. Japanese immigrants often worked in agriculture, particularly in California where they were involved in farming and fishing. Discriminatory laws and attitudes limited their job opportunities, leading many to take on low-paying and physically demanding work.
